1

Mid Level Backend Developer Jobs in Utah (NOW HIRING)

TechOps Engineer - Mid Level About the Role? We're looking for a hands-on Mid-Level TechOps ... What You Bring * 1-4 years of hands-on experience in DevOps, TechOps, Systems Engineering, or a ...

TechOps Engineer - Mid Level About the Role? We're looking for a hands-on Mid-Level TechOps ... What You Bring * 1-4 years of hands-on experience in DevOps, TechOps, Systems Engineering, or a ...

Senior Ruby on Rails Backend Developer

Springville, UT · On-site

$131.80K - $162.30K/yr

Ultimately, we are looking for a top-level Senior Ruby on Rails Developer that can create, clean ... Your responsibilities include developing back-end components and building/maintaining the mobile ...

Mid-Level Landscape Architect

Sandy, UT · On-site

$65.60K - $90.30K/yr

DOE Think Architecture Inc is seeking a Full Time talented, detail-oriented Mid-Level Landscape ... Develop project design throughout different phases of development from programming through ...

Architectural Design Facility Programming Construction Administration PREFERRED candidates should have: 3D experience NCARB REQUIRED: Requisite proficiency in AutoCAD Minimum 5 years of experience ...

Roughly 30% RESPONSIBILITIES include all phases of: • Architectural Design • Facility Programming • Construction Administration PREFERRED candidates should have: • 3D experience • NCARB ...

Senior Backend Engineer - AI Platform

Salt Lake City, UT · On-site +1

$118.50K - $156.30K/yr

Conduct code reviews (comment, approve, seek revisions, merge), mentor junior and mid-level ... Proficiency in backend development, with expertise in Java or C#, frameworks like SpringBoot ...

Senior Backend Engineer - AI Platform

Salt Lake City, UT · On-site +1

$118.50K - $156.30K/yr

Conduct code reviews (comment, approve, seek revisions, merge), mentor junior and mid-level ... Proficiency in backend development, with expertise in Java or C#, frameworks like SpringBoot ...

Sr. Software Engineer (AI & Backend)

Salt Lake City, UT · On-site +1

$118.50K - $156.30K/yr

Conduct code reviews (comment, approve, seek revisions, merge), mentor junior and mid-level ... Proficiency in backend development, with proficiency expertise in Java or C#, and frameworks like ...

Sr. Software Engineer (AI & Backend)

Salt Lake City, UT · On-site +1

$118.50K - $156.30K/yr

Conduct code reviews (comment, approve, seek revisions, merge), mentor junior and mid-level ... Proficiency in backend development, with proficiency expertise in Java or C#, and frameworks like ...

next page

Showing results 1-20

Mid Level Backend Developer information

See Utah salary details

$10

$52

$76

How much do mid level backend developer jobs pay per hour?

As of May 30, 2026, the average hourly pay for mid level backend developer in Utah is $52.56, according to ZipRecruiter salary data. Most workers in this role earn between $43.12 and $62.16 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as a Mid Level Backend Developer, and why are they important?

To thrive as a Mid Level Backend Developer, you need strong programming skills in languages like Java, Python, or Node.js, a solid understanding of server-side logic, and experience with relational and non-relational databases. Familiarity with frameworks (such as Spring or Express), RESTful API development, version control systems (like Git), and containerization tools (like Docker) is typically required. Effective problem-solving, collaboration, and clear communication are standout soft skills for this role. These abilities are crucial for building reliable, scalable backend systems and working efficiently within development teams.

What are some typical challenges a Mid Level Backend Developer might face when working on large-scale applications?

As a Mid Level Backend Developer, you may frequently encounter challenges related to maintaining code quality and ensuring scalability as applications grow. Managing database performance, optimizing API responses, and integrating with legacy systems are common tasks that require both technical skill and problem-solving ability. Collaboration with frontend developers, DevOps engineers, and QA testers is essential to ensure smooth deployments and consistent user experiences. Staying up-to-date with new frameworks and technologies, while balancing project deadlines, is also a key part of the role.

What are Mid Level Backend Developers?

Mid Level Backend Developers are software engineers who specialize in developing and maintaining the server-side logic, databases, and APIs that power web and mobile applications. They usually have a few years of professional experience and are proficient in programming languages like Java, Python, Node.js, or Ruby. These developers are responsible for ensuring that data flows efficiently between the server and users, optimizing performance, and collaborating with front-end developers and other team members. Their role often includes troubleshooting server issues, writing automated tests, and implementing security best practices.

What is the difference between Mid Level Backend Developer vs Junior Backend Developer?

AspectMid Level Backend DeveloperJunior Backend Developer
Experience2-4 years0-2 years
SkillsProficient in backend frameworks, databases, API developmentBasic understanding of backend concepts, learning frameworks
ResponsibilitiesDeveloping features, troubleshooting, code reviewsAssisting in tasks, learning codebase, bug fixing
Work EnvironmentCollaborates with teams, independent problem-solving

The main difference between a Mid Level Backend Developer and a Junior Backend Developer lies in experience and skill level. Mid level developers have more hands-on experience, handle complex tasks independently, and contribute significantly to project development. Junior developers are still learning, focusing on foundational tasks and gaining industry knowledge. This distinction helps employers identify the right candidate for different stages of project involvement.

What are the most commonly searched types of Backend Developer jobs in Utah? The most popular types of Backend Developer jobs in Utah are:
What cities in Utah are hiring for Mid Level Backend Developer jobs? Cities in Utah with the most Mid Level Backend Developer job openings:
Techops Engineer -Mid Level

Techops Engineer -Mid Level

ACD Direct

Farmington, UT • On-site

$52K - $85K/yr

Full-time

Medical, Dental, Vision, Retirement, PTO

Posted 19 days ago


Job description

TechOps Engineer - Mid Level
About the Role?
We're looking for a hands-on Mid-Level TechOps Engineer to join our fully remote team and help us build, automate, and maintain the infrastructure that powers contact center technology for B2B clients across the country. If you can own a CI/CD pipeline end-to-end, feel at home in a cloud console, and care about getting the details right - we want to talk.
What do we do?
ACD Direct, Inc. is an innovative, virtual company that thrives on brokering solutions for our non-profit clients. ACD's heartbeat and competitive edge is powered by our people. Our company has grown from providing routine call center services to providing high-level, full-scale donor support resources and products. Our proprietary scripting engine, web forms and custom-built reporting enable clients to successfully conduct large-scale fundraising campaigns with accuracy and creativity. ACD is a B2B Contact Center Technology company building and operating the infrastructure that keeps modern contact centers running at scale. Our platform is cloud-native, security-first, and built by a fully distributed team spread across the United States. We move fast, document everything, and treat operational excellence as a core value - not an afterthought.
Limitations:
Applicant preferred to be located within a 50 mile radius of Salt Lake City, Utah. Although position is remote employee will be required to visit data center on a quarterly basis. It is not required for the employee to be located in the state of Utah.
What will you do?
  • Build, manage, and continuously improve CI/CD pipelines for serverless and containerized applications with minimal supervision.
  • Automate deployment, configuration, scaling, and monitoring workflows using best-practice tooling.
  • Monitor infrastructure, applications, and services - investigate alerts, diagnose root causes, and resolve incidents independently.
  • Contribute to Infrastructure as Code (IaC) and configuration management initiatives.
  • Participate in security reviews, vulnerability assessments, and PCI DSS compliance monitoring - including patching and audit log maintenance.
  • Collaborate with Engineering and QA teams to improve deployment velocity and release quality.
  • Help onboard and guide junior team members, sharing knowledge and best practices.
  • Maintain clear, accurate documentation for systems, runbooks, and operational processes.
  • Participate in Agile SDLC ceremonies and contribute to sprint-based delivery.

What You Bring
  • 1-4 years of hands-on experience in DevOps, TechOps, Systems Engineering, or a closely related field.
  • Solid experience with CI/CD tooling - GitHub Actions, GitLab CI, Jenkins, or equivalent.
  • Comfortable working with cloud platforms (AWS, Azure, or GCP); familiar with core services like compute, networking, storage, and IAM.
  • Working knowledge of containerization (Docker) and basic orchestration concepts.
  • Experience with scripting or automation (Bash, Python, or similar).
  • Understanding of infrastructure-as-code principles; some hands-on experience with Terraform or equivalent.
  • Familiarity with security fundamentals - access controls, encryption, patching, and audit logging.
  • Strong written communication skills; you write documentation that teammates actually want to read.
  • Ability to work independently in a fully remote, async-friendly environment.

Nice to Have
  • Experience supporting PCI DSS compliance requirements.
  • Exposure to Kubernetes or container orchestration platforms.
  • Familiarity with observability tooling (Datadog, Grafana, CloudWatch, or similar).
  • Background in contact center, telecom, or SaaS infrastructure environments.
  • Experience with SMS platforms or telecommunications APIs.

Growth & Mentorship
This role sits squarely in the middle of our TechOps career ladder, with a clear path toward senior-level ownership. You'll be supported by senior engineers who are invested in your growth and expected to start passing that investment down to junior teammates. We prioritize people who are curious, communicative, and always looking to level up.
How we will support you?
Salary:
  • $52,000-85,000/yr depending on experience level

- Remote and Inoffice Work
- Equipment Provided:
  • Laptop
  • Headset
  • Monthly Cell Phone Stipend
  • Monthly Internet Stipend

- Benefits:
  • Medical/Vision and Dental Insurance
  • Personal Accident Insurance
  • 401(k)/Roth with matching
  • Tiered PTO based upon length of employment
  • Discounts & Life Services offered through Optum EAP

- Team Environment - The opportunity to work with a great team who strives for excellence, where the average tenure is well over 6 years. (Not bad for a company who has been in business for 20 years!)
**ACD Direct, Inc. is an equal opportunity employer and values diversity. All aspects of employment including the decision to hire, promote, discipline, or discharge, will be based on merit, competence, performance, and business needs. We do not discriminate based on any status protected under federal, state, or local law. We are a fully remote company. Our team spans every U.S. time zone and we are committed to building an inclusive, async-friendly culture where great work speaks for itself.
By submitting an application to this position I acknowledge that ACD may use automated tools, including Applicant Tracking Systems (ATS) and Artificial Intelligence (AI), to assist in reviewing and prioritizing my application based on job-related qualifications. I understand these tools are assistive only and that final hiring decisions are made by human reviewers. I have read the Use of Automated Screening & AI Tools disclosure and understand I may request a manual review or reasonable accommodation by contacting acdhr@acddirect.com.